Arsenal target Daniel Sturridge is willing to complete a move away from Liverpool to join West Ham in the summer transfers window, according to report from The Daily Express.

The news outlet further reported that the England international has told his friends he would consider a move to join the Hammers, Sturridge, 27, was strongly been linked with a move to The Emirates during the previous summer transfer window, but Wenger fail to push ahead for a deal to seal the signing of the England international.

However, Sturridge has fallen out of favour with Liverpool as he all featured in only 23 games under Liverpool manager Jurgen Klopp, and his career continues to be blighted by injury – sounds like he’d fit right in at Arsenal then.

The likes of Origi and Firmino are now ahead on his in the pecking order, and he’s not featured in a single Premier League game since November.
